The European Parliamentary Elections (Amendment) (No.2) Regulations 2009

Made 31th March 2009

Coming into force in accordance with regulation 1(2)

The Secretary of State makes these Regulations in exercise of the powers conferred by sections 6(5) and 7 of the European Parliamentary Elections Act 20021and sections 17 and 18 of the European Parliament (Representation) Act 20032.

The Secretary of State has consulted the Electoral Commission pursuant to section 7(1) and (2)(a) of the Political Parties, Elections and Referendums Act 20003and section 17(4) of the European Parliament (Representation) Act 2003.

In accordance with section 13(2) of the European Parliamentary Elections Act 20024and section 18(4) of the European Parliament (Representation) Act 2003, a draft of these Regulations has been laid before and approved by a resolution of each House of Parliament.

S-1 Citation, commencement and extent

Citation, commencement and extent

1.—(1) These Regulations may be cited as the European Parliamentary Elections (Amendment) (No.2) Regulations 2009.

(2) These Regulations shall come into force on the day after the day on which they are made.

(3) These Regulations extend to England, Wales, Scotland and Gibraltar.

S-2 Amendments to the European Parliamentary Elections Regulations 2004

Amendments to the European Parliamentary Elections Regulations 2004

2.—(1) The European Parliamentary Elections Regulations 20045are amended as follows.

(2) In Schedule 1 (European Parliamentary elections rules)6, rule 53(3) (the count), for “them” substitute “the numbers or other unique identifying marks printed on the back of the papers”.

(3) In Schedule 2 (absent voting)7

(a)

(a) in paragraph 36(7) (requiring personal identifiers from existing absent voters), for “an elections” substitute “an election”;

(b)

(b) in paragraph 39(1)(a) (consequences of failure or refusal to provide personal identifiers), for “voting records” substitute “absent voting records”;

(c)

(c) in paragraph 54(10) (lost postal ballot papers), for “regulation 52” substitute “paragraph 52”; and

(d)

(d) in paragraph 70(1) (forwarding of documents), for “those rules” substitute “the European Parliamentary elections rules”.
